Showing revision 2Small editor for quick-and-dirty
AutoHotkey script development or testing
Author: jballi
Homepage: http://www.autohotkey.com/forum/viewtopic.php?t=36159
Family: MicrosoftWindowsEditors
License: Freeware, Open source
Availability: yes
Platform: Windows
Key features:
- Sandbox. Scripts are edited and run in an isolated workspace. OK, not entirely. See the Issues/Considerations? section for more information.
- Restore & Revert. Restore to a specific point-in-time or revert to the last saved workspace.
- Run. Run the current script or just the commands in the selected text.
- Stop. Terminate a lost or unruly script at any time.
- HiEdit?. The HiEdit? control is used to display/edit the workspace and to display the restore points in the pop-up Restore Point viewer. In addition to syntax highlighting, the control has additional features like a line numbers bar and extended undo/redo.
- AutoHotkey Path. If desired, the path to the AutoHotkey program can be specified. This is useful if AutoHotkey is not installed (portable developers) or if you want to test using alternate versions of AutoHotkey.
